Night shift: evacuation-chair store on Stairwell C, Level 3, was restocked today. Two Havermont chairs serviced, one sent to Drayle Safety for repair. Check the seal on the store door at 02:00 rounds. If the seal is broken, log it and re-secure. Door access for the store uses the pass below.

staff pass of fajop-kajop = bdg-H-83

GridForge 4.2 caps spreadsheet export memory at 512 MB per worker. Plugin authors must stream rows; buffering the full sheet will OOM on exports above 200k rows. Test with the bundled stress fixture before submitting. Releases failing the memory gate are rejected automatically. Sign your plugin bundle before upload using the key below.

rollout seal: bky9_aBG1gvAyU

Quick note for the sync: the Quillscale autoscaler sometimes lags when queue depth spikes on the Bramford cluster. If workers aren't scaling, check the `scaler_decisions` table for stale heartbeats — anything older than two minutes means the poller died. Restart it with `quillctl poller restart`. To inspect the decisions table directly, connect to the metrics database using the connection string below.

primary connection of yagep-kahip = redis://giliel_svc:zYiKsLL2PLpfPL@db-348f.xolmarsys.corp:5432/fenwyn

Stonemill's order-cutoff rule rejects bakery orders submitted after 16:00 local for next-day fulfillment; the check runs server-side in the Ovenline service and cannot be bypassed by client clock manipulation, since the cutoff is evaluated against the fulfillment site's timezone record. Overrides are logged and require the manager role. Security note: the override endpoint is internal-only and authenticates against the Ovenline admin plane using the key below.

API key for kahop-bagef: zpat2_yb

## Formula sandbox tuning

User-supplied formulas in Gridmoor execute inside a restricted interpreter with hard ceilings on time, memory, and call depth. Reviewers should confirm any change to these ceilings is justified in the PR description, since raising them widens the abuse surface. Defaults were chosen from production traces. The current limits are as follows.

limits module of tafog-fawip:
WEIGHTS = {
    "julix": 57,
    "lamys": 992,
    "kasvan": 209,
    "quenok": 750,
    "alddor": 259,
    "oliath": 1009,
    "wenix": 815,
}